Lakeside Café
Share on FacebookShare on Twitter

Situated next to a lake within Roy Amer Reserve is the Lakeside Café, a laid-back, family friendly venue that Manager Amy Yu has been running for the past year.

“I graduated with a degree in civil engineering just before COVID-19 and found it difficult to find a job in China,” Amy says. “I decided to move to South Australia and fell in love with the area. When the opportunity came up to manage the café, I jumped at it.”

The sunny suburban café serves breakfast, lunch, and dinner, catering to a wide demographic from young couples to families and older diners.

“We have a loyal customer base who I really love. Everyone here is so friendly and welcoming that it makes me love working in the café,” says Amy.  

“One of the most unique aspects of the café is that we are located right next to a reserve so people dining outdoors feel like they are surrounded by nature.”

Amy adds that this location combined with her team’s warm hospitality makes it the perfect spot for both a quick takeaway meal or a dine-in lunch with family and friends.

Serving up classic café food, Amy says favourites include the Prosciutto Scacciata, or pizza herb bread with prosciutto, rocket, and bocconcini cheese, with the Gourmet Veg Burger or Seafood Platters always a hit later in the day.

Alongside its impressive menu range, Lakeside Café serves up Mocopan’s Pasquale coffee, which Amy says is a favourite among guests for its smooth, full-bodied flavour that releases an irresistible aroma.

With notes of chocolate, caramel, and sweetly spicy aroma, she says it complements both dairy and non-dairy milk.

“Before I started managing Lakeside Café, I didn’t know a lot about coffee, but with Mocopan helping me with any technical issues and providing support, I’ve learned so much,” Amy says.

In the future, Amy plans to continue upgrading the café and building upon its menu.
